
Dublin, Ireland
1. Required Documents:
Completed online application (via CAO for EU or TU Dublin International Application Portal for non-EU)
Official high school transcripts and certificates (with grading scale)
Copy of passport or national ID
Personal Statement outlining academic interests and career goals
One academic reference letter
Proof of English language proficiency
Portfolio (for Architecture, Design, or Creative programs)
2. Entrance Test Requirements:
Most undergraduate programs do not require an entrance exam.
Engineering and Science programs may require strong grades in Mathematics and Science subjects.
Art and Design programs require a portfolio assessment instead of an entrance test.
Music programs may include an audition or interview stage.
3. Language Test Requirements:
IELTS Academic: Minimum 6.0 overall (no band below 5.5)
TOEFL iBT: Minimum 80 overall
PTE Academic: Minimum score of 59
Duolingo English Test: Minimum 100
Applicants who studied in English for at least 3 years may be exempted.
